Chapter 195 A Computer Professor Invited from the University of Hong Kong
The 80s were the decade of microcomputers. In the next 30 years, most of the most important companies in the computer industry, Microsoft, Intel, Apple, Dell, Compaq, most of them laid the foundation in the 80s.
Microsoft will also not realize that it will develop in the future by relying on the operation system of DOS, INDOS and other PC computers.
Intel also did not realize that its main business in the future is to make CPUs for PC computers, and it will become the most profitable semiconductor company in Silicon Valley.
Before IBM launched the PC plan, companies such as Microsoft and Intel could only look up to Apple, which had risen like a dark horse, with jealousy.
You must know that Apple was only founded in April 1976, and it has become the hegemon in the field of microcomputers in a few years.
However, in the era of PC computers, IBM chose to cooperate with Microsoft, Intel and other companies to vigorously promote the influence of PC computers. Apple, on the other hand, disdains to follow the trend of PCs and produces Apple computers on its own, trying to fight against IBM's PCs.
But after the mid-80s, Apple computers were finally reduced to niche computers, and although they had millions of die-hard fans, they could only watch more than 95% of the world's personal computers become the world of PC computers. Because of Apple's mismanagement, shareholders shirked their responsibilities and actually kicked Jobs out of the board. However, after driving out Jobs, Apple sank more and more.
After Jobs left Apple, he started his own business, but it was impressive, and Apple shareholders had to invite Jobs back to clean up the mess. It wasn't until the beginning of the 21st century that Jobs aimed at the MP3 field and launched the iPod, and when piracy was rampant in the MP3 market, Apple decided to cooperate with record companies to provide genuine music downloads, which won the support of most record companies and also gained wide support from music listeners, which was a great success. In order to sell genuine music, Apple developed a set of online stores that sell genuine music, and later this music sales store gradually became an Apple App Store that sells apps, games, e-books, movies, including Vientiane, and any entertainment resources. Later, the core charm of the Apple mobile phone, iPhone, and tablet iPad, all lie in the application of Vientiane on the Apple computer.
Of course, in 80 years, Apple's operating income has exceeded $100 million, and its annual profit has exceeded tens of millions of dollars. Although Apple's influence is greater than that of Microsoft and Intel in this matter.
But compared with a giant like IBM, which has sales of tens of billions of dollars, Apple's strength is hundreds of times worse! Later, the PC computer defeated the Apple computer, which was actually a very unfair competition, just like the unfairness of hundreds of people beating a few people and triumphantly declaring victory.
After the computer was bought, both Shaohuai and the Mei sisters couldn't put it down.
However, here's the problem – no one is going to do it.
Although Zhang Shaojie has experience in making PC computers, he will only use it under the premise of having an indos system. As for Apple computers, it is easy for computer technicians to learn to use it, but it is a headache for Zhang Shaojie and others!
The Appleii is an 8-bit microcomputer, this computer has a Motorola 6502 processor, a CPU speed of only 1MHz, 48KB of memory integrated into the circuit board, and no hard disk! Originally, it was only pre-installed with Microsoft's basic language interpreter as a system. If you're willing to add some money, you can buy a copy of the DOS on Apple's system!
However, the four Apple computers that Zhang Shaojie bought only have one set of basic, which can be used to write programs, and everyone can only look at high-tech products and sigh!
"Brother, why don't you find a computer master and teach us! I can use my evenings to learn about the computer! Besides, it's almost winter vacation, and if you learn how to use a computer during the whole winter vacation, it's not a waste of time! Shaohuai said.
"Well, I want to start from scratch too!" Zhang Shaojie agreed.
If you want to learn, you must find a master who has real talent and real learning. Zhang Shaojie asked a professor of computer science from the University of Hong Kong to teach computer knowledge to himself and others at home.
Jin Yong has established a good relationship with the University of Hong Kong, because Jin Yong has donated millions to the University of Hong Kong. With Jin Yong's help, Zhang Shaojie contacted a computer professor who had returned from overseas at the University of Hong Kong.
The professor is in his 40s. His name is Huang Tingjun.
Originally, Huang Tingjun saw the business opportunities in the American personal computer industry and was ready to show his skills, but later, as Apple computers swept the market, Huang Tingjun's company only sold 5 computers, and announced its dissolution because of the bleak future.
Last year, Wong Ting-kwan was invited by the University of Hong Kong to start teaching. Because Zhang Shaojie's price is 500 Hong Kong dollars an hour's lecture fee, and Huang Tingjun does owe a lot of debt because of opening a company, he is financially embarrassed.
also degraded his dignity and went to Zhang Shaojie's home to tutor him in computer courses.
"Hello, Mr. Huang!" Zhang Shaojie said respectfully.
Huang Tingjun nodded slightly and said: "Zhang Shaojie, you are not simple, you are only 17 years old, and you have become a famous writer in Hong Kong!" What is even more rare is that you can be intellectually aware of the importance of knowledge. But why would you want to learn computers? ”
Zhang Shaojie said with a smile: "I have always believed that the development of computers will have a profound impact on all aspects of human society. The times are rolling forward, if you can't keep up with the trend of the times, no matter how rich and status, you are still a laggard abandoned by the times! While you are still young and able to absorb and learn new things, it obviously doesn't hurt to learn a little more computer knowledge! ”
Then Zhang Shaojie introduced Shaohuai, Anita Mui, and Mei Aifang to Professor Huang, saying that the three of them would also observe.
Professor Huang Tingjun didn't care, teaching one is teaching, and teaching four people is also teaching.
When you get started with any academic, you must explain the historical and humanistic background of this academic, and if you don't understand the development background of an industry, you can't better grasp a discipline.
The same goes for computer literacy.
The first day of classes.
Huang Tingjun started with mechanical calculators hundreds of years ago, and mechanical computers were divided into the first generation of computers.
Later, in the 40s, the tube computer developed in the United States belonged to the second generation of computers. At this time, the efficiency of computers was greatly improved compared to the first generation of computers.
After World War II, the application of semiconductors made the computer industry enter the era of the third generation of computers. It was in this era that Silicon Valley emerged—Bell engineer Shockley invented the transistor, Texas Instruments became the first company in the semiconductor industry to operate commercially, Shockley created Fairchild, and Fairchild rebelled out of the school.
And at the beginning of the 70s, integrated circuits were used on a large scale, and the fourth generation of computers gradually took shape. The fourth generation of computer chips contains more and more components, and computers can become more and more powerful. And, microcomputers began to appear
For mainframes, both 16-bit and 32-bit chips exist. However, the chips used in today's microcomputers are basically 8-bit chips.
Huang Tingjun said: "Appleii is an 8-bit microcomputer using Motorola 6502 chip, which is enough for learning basic computer knowledge and writing some simple programs for individuals. However, just learning how to use an Apple computer is not enough to get started with computers."
"How do you get started?" Shaohuai raised his hand and asked.
Huang Tingjun said with a smile: "That is, read more and practice more." Software, hardware, all kinds of computer knowledge, are widely involved. Not only to 'know what it is', but also to 'know why it is'! However, it is difficult for one person's energy to take care of everything, so some people are proficient in software and some are proficient in hardware. I don't know, what do you want to learn? ”
"Let's start with software programming languages," says Zhang.
Huang Tingjun said with more interest: "Okay, then in the future, our main course is to learn computer programming languages!" Software is a program, is a series of computer instructions, the software program directs the computer-related hardware to complete the corresponding actions, to achieve a certain function, it can be said that the software program is the soul of the computer. Without software, a computer is like a car without gasoline, and it doesn't work at all."
To understand a piece of knowledge, it is necessary to understand the history of such knowledge. With Huang Tingjun's narration, everyone began to immerse themselves in the development history of the early software industry
The earliest programmer was the poet Byron's daughter Ade, in 1834 Adele met the mechanical computer designer Adecy, and the imaginative girl Adele for mathematics designed the most primitive program for Abbic - binary code composed of 0 and 1!
Binary code is a program that has been widely used for more than 100 years in the era of punching machines.
Huang Tingjun said: "Binary code, we call it 'machine code'! In the era of punching machines, reading 'machine codes' was a headache, and no one could read the meaning of binary codes without using a specific codebook. Imagine, a slip of paper is monotonously written with 0 and 1, who can analyze the meaning from the monotonous characters at a glance? Even cryptographers are prone to errors when reading binary code! So, binary machine code is not an ideal programming language! ”
(To be continued)